    The All Blacks have finished preparations for tomorrow morning's Rugby Championship rematch against the Springboks in Cape Town


    First-five Damian McKenzie says accuracy will be the key to a New Zealand win, after letting a 10-point lead slip away in the first test in Johannesburg.



    In the NPC, Bay Of Plenty have thrashed Manawatu 68-14 in Rotorua to move to second on the ladder.



    World number one Jannik Sinner has won the first set against Britain's Jack Draper in their US tennis Open semi-final in New York.

    It's the first time Draper's dropped a set in the tournament.



    Swimmer Cameron Leslie has finished fourth in the men's S4 50-metre freestyle final at the Paralympics in Paris.

    Meanwhile, para-athlete Anna Grimaldi also finished fourth in the women's T47 long jump final, while Holly Robinson has claimed sixth in the women's F46 javelin final.



    Former Wallaby Mark Nawaqanitawase has scored in his NRL debut during the Roosters' 36-28 win over the Rabbitohs in Sydney to take second on the ladder.

    Meanwhile, the Eels have handed the Tigers the wooden spoon after a 60-26 belting in Campbelltown.



    Three-time champion Primoz Roglic has taken the general classification lead with two stages remaining in cycling's Vuelta a Espana.
